Rentmonitor Server CircleCI

The rent monitor server API.

The default configuration uses a postgresql database. But any SQL database supported by loopback can be used.

In case you are using postgresql please run these commands to setup the databases:

createuser $RDS_USERNAME -P
CREATE USER $RDS_USERNAME WITH ENCRYPTED PASSWORD $RDS_PASSWORD;
createuser rentmonitor_test -P

createdb rentmonitor_test --owner rentmonitor_test --username <user with createdb permissions>

createdb $RDS_DB_NAME --owner $RDS_USERNAME --username <user with createdb permissions>
CREATE DATABASE $RDS_DB_NAME OWNER $RDS_USERNAME;

To setup both databases run:

npm run migrate npm run migrate:testdb

If you have trouble running the tests because the database schema is not up-to-date please run:

npm run migrate:testdb

Raspberry Setup

docker network create rentmonitor-network docker run --network rentmonitor-network --name postgresdb -e POSTGRES_PASSWORD=postgres -d --restart unless-stopped arm32v6/postgres:13-alpine

docker exec -it postgresdb bash psql -h localhost -p 5432 -U postgres -W

CREATE ROLE $RDS_USERNAME WITH LOGIN PASSWORD $RDS_PASSWORD; CREATE DATABASE $RDS_DB_NAME OWNER $RDS_USER;

Build docker image

docker build -t arm32v6/rentmonitor-server-loopback:1.0.1 .

Save docker image to file

docker save -o /tmp/rentmonitor-server-loopback-1.0.1.img arm32v6/rentmonitor-server-loopback:1.0.1

Copy image via ssh to Raspberry Pi0W

scp /tmp/rentmonitor-server-loopback-1.0.1.img $RENTMONITOR_DEPLOY_HOST:~/rentmonitor-server-loopback-1.0.1.img

Install image on Raspberry Pi0W

docker load -i rentmonitor-server-loopback-1.0.1.img

Start container on Raspberry Pi0W

docker run --network rentmonitor-network --name rentmonitor-server -e RDS_HOSTNAME -e RDS_PORT -e RDS_DB_NAME -e RDS_USERNAME -e RDS_PASSWORD -e RENTMONITOR_DB_ENCRYPTION_SECRET -e RENTMONITOR_DB_ENCRYPTION_SALT -e RENTMONITOR_JWT_SECRET -p 3000:3000 -d arm32v6/rentmonitor-server-loopback:1.0.1

Restore database dump

cat rentmonitor_dump.sql | docker exec -i postgresdb psql -U $RDS_USERNAME
